14-626. Intentionally, defined for crimes against children.
To find that the defendant [acted intentionally1] 2 [intentionally left or abandoned the child 3] you must find that it was the defendant’s conscious objective to [leave or abandon]2 [endanger] [torture, cruelly confine, or cruelly punish] [or] [expose to the inclemency of the weather] the child.
USE NOTES
1. This phrase tracks Element 3 in UJI 14-623 NMRA.
2. Choose applicable alternative or alternatives.
3. This phrase tracks the language in UJIs 14-606 and 14-607 NMRA for crimes of abandonment.
[Adopted by Supreme Court Order No. 18-8300-012, effective for all cases pending or filed on or after December 31, 2018.]
